RDCM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2015 in Review
10 of the 3,753 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Radcom (RDCM) for Q1 2015, worth a combined $13M — down 18% from $15.8M a quarter earlier.
Sellers outnumbered buyers: 4 funds closed out of RDCM and 2 opened new positions — a net loss of 2 holders — while 3 trimmed existing stakes and 3 added.
The largest buyer was Menta Capital, opening a new position worth an estimated $418K. The largest seller was EAM Investors, exiting entirely with an estimated $649K sold.
